Abstract

The invention relates to an antifreezing and anti-cracking hand cream which comprises, by weight, 60-70% of a water phase component, 25-35% of an oil phase component and 3-8% of a functional additive, wherein the water phase component comprises, by weight, 30-40% of pure water, 8-15% of glycerol, 3-8% of urea, 2-4% of hyaluronic acid, 1-3% of maltitol, 0.2-0.35% of sodium glucoheptonate, and the oil phase component comprises, by weight, 8-15% of vaseline, 5-10% of mineral oil, 3-8% of shea butter and 2-5% of beeswax. The invention also relates to a preparation process of the antifreezing and anti-cracking hand cream. The invention converts five industrial pain points of heavy, mud rubbing, stimulation, shortness and instability into quantifiable engineering indexes one by one, and obtains order of magnitude advantages in four dimensions of absorption speed, water washing resistance, repair speed and low-temperature stability, and simultaneously, the process is kept simple and the cost is controllable.

Antifreezing and anti-cracking hand cream and preparation process thereof Technical Field The invention relates to the technical field of daily chemicals, in particular to an antifreezing and anti-cracking hand cream and a preparation process thereof. Background The hand cream is a skin care product specially used for protecting and nourishing hand skin, and belongs to a skin care cream. The hand skin care product has the core effects of forming a layer of protective film on the surface of the hand skin, effectively locking moisture, preventing excessive evaporation of the moisture, and supplementing necessary grease and nutritional ingredients, so that the softness, smoothness and health of the hand skin are maintained. Hand cream is a semi-solid skin care preparation, usually in the form of a cream or cream, and is formulated to provide long-lasting moisturizing, moisturizing and protecting effects for hand skin. The main difference between the hand cream and the body lotion is that the hand cream is thicker in texture and stronger in sealing property, and can better cope with the characteristics of frequent contact of hand skin with the outside and easiness in drying. At present, the existing hand cream has heavy greasy feeling, the traditional antifreezing hand cream contains a large amount of vaseline and mineral oil, a hand image is wrapped with an oil film after being smeared, the hand image is slipped by a user, fingerprints are arranged on a mobile phone screen, the mud rubbing phenomenon is serious, the proportion of a thickening agent and a high polymer colloid in the formula is improper, and the thickening agent and the high polymer colloid are mixed with skin cutin or external dust to form mud, and the mud is slow to absorb, so that the macromolecular grease is excessive in component, difficult to absorb by skin, and long in surface residual time, and influences daily work and life. In addition, medical staff is not suitable for frequent hand washing and disinfectant use, common hand cream cannot provide lasting protection, outdoor workers have poor effects, the common hand cream is quickly failed in a cold and cold air environment, sensitive muscles are not selected, and most of antifreezing hand cream is too irritative, and sensitive muscles cannot be used. Disclosure of Invention The invention aims to provide an antifreezing and anti-cracking hand cream, which converts five industrial pain points of heavy, mud rubbing, stimulation, shortness and instability into quantifiable engineering indexes one by one, achieves order-of-magnitude advantages in four dimensions of absorption speed, washing resistance, repair speed and low-temperature stability, and simultaneously keeps the process simple and the cost controllable. An antifreezing and anti-cracking hand cream comprises a water phase component, an oil phase component and a functional additive; According to the weight percentage of the components, 60-70% Of water phase components, 25-35% of oil phase components and 3-8% of functional additives; Wherein, the The water phase comprises 30-40% of pure water, 8-15% of glycerol, 3-8% of urea, 2-4% of hyaluronic acid, 1-3% of maltitol and 0.2-0.35% of sodium glucoheptonate; the oil phase comprises 8-15% of Vaseline, 5-10% of mineral oil, 3-8% of shea butter and 2-5% of beeswax. Further, the oil phase component also comprises 1-2% of vitamin E. Specifically, the functional additive comprises 1-2% of vitamin B6, 2-4% of glycerol stearate, 0.5-1% of antibacterial agent and 0.3-0.8% of essence. The second aim of the invention is to provide a preparation process of the antifreezing and anti-cracking hand cream, which comprises the following steps, S1, preparing a water phase, namely heating pure water to 75-80 ℃, adding glycerol, urea, hyaluronic acid, maltitol and sodium glucoheptonate, and stirring for dissolution; S2, preparing an oil phase, namely mixing vaseline, mineral oil, shea butter, beeswax and vitamin E, and heating to 75-80 ℃ until the mixture is completely melted; S3, performing preliminary emulsification, namely slowly adding the oil phase into the water phase at the temperature of 75-80 ℃ and stirring while adding; S4, homogenizing and emulsifying, namely treating for 15-20 minutes by using a high-speed homogenizer to form a stable emulsion system; S5, cooling and emulsifying, namely naturally cooling to 55-60 ℃ under stirring; s6, mixing an additive; S7, filling and packaging. Further, in step S3, the oil phase is slowly added to the water phase at 75 ℃, stirring is performed while adding, and the rotation speed of the stirring rod is 2000-3000 rpm.
